Abstract
A method to design absolutely stable observers for multiple-output time-varying free nonlinear dynamical systems is presented. This method can be used to measure even those signal parameters that are nonlinear functions of the observations. An adaptive Fourier analyzer has been designed by using the proposed method. Simulation and realization results of this observer are provided.<>
